A New Film Chronicles the War Against the “Vampire Fish”They latch onto other fish, create a wound with their razor-sharp teeth and tongue, and suck out blood ... they are mere parasites, attaching themselves most often to sharks and other sea mammals.
The invasive sea lamprey brought Great Lakes fishing to its knees in the fifties and sixties, until local communities and scientists battled back. The new film ‘The Fish Thief’ explores the fight.
